2D Animation (Loops, Sequences) Needed for DJ Visualizer Project
Budget: $750 – $1,500 USD
Hello! My name is John and I am an electronic music DJ and producer in search of an animator/studio to create scenes that will be used for a visualizer in a large project. More specifically, I have recorded a live performance lasting an hour and 44 seconds (1:00:44 total length) that I would like to release paired with an 2D-animated, story-based visualizer (do not panic at the length, much of the visualizer will be looped sections, but it will still be a longer/bigger project in its entirety). This is where you come in!
Optimally, I’m looking for animation in a 16:9 aspect ratio at around 12 frames per second. I am welcoming all styles to apply, but priority may be given to those that specialize in pixel art replication or anime styles. Many (if not all) animations/loops require beatmatching (in time with music provided), so experience with music video animation is a big plus. Both character (people, animals, robots) and environmental animation is required (static vistas with select moving components).
All details (including audio source material, a brand moodboard, aesthetic guide/aspiring style of the project, characters, environments, visual references, and detailed script) can be obtained via messaging me directly/submitting an offer.
Overall, the world/aesthetic of this story is based on medieval role-playing games/2D side scroller video games. I’m imagining a bright, colorful world centered around nostalgia, channeling the fun (and grit) of adventure.
In my most ideal world where I get to fund every loop and make the project exactly how I'd like it, the visualizer created would comprise of around nine (9) main loops clocking in at less than 1 minute for each, acting almost like sections of the mix (some will be as short as 10-15 seconds depending). In addition to these loops, there are around seven (7) scenes/sequences ranging from static, panned frames to longer animations (again, all details of scene concepts can be sent over per request). However, some scenes (including loop and sequence length) may simply be cut for budget.
